2nd European Kicking Camp, Budapest, July 21-22, 2007
Just to inform some people who might be interested...
We are running an extremely busy schedule this year, roughly 20 games altogether in 2 separate leagues (1 Austrian, 1 International).
http://gaborsviatko.googlepages.com/home
I'm doing pretty good, especially punting. So far I landed 8 of 11 punts I20, not including one that landed on the 21yd line.
Also, the 2nd European Kicking Camp is approaching fast. The camp will be in Budapest on July 21-22, 2007. Contact me if you are interested in attending the event!
http://gaborsviatko.googlepages.com/europeankickingcamp
So far the list includes participants from 10 European countries, 7 national kickers/punters:
